Instalando e configurando o IceWarp Mail Server

Tutorial de instalação e configuração o IceWarp Mail Server.

[ Hits: 12.372 ]

Por: Flávio Zarur Lucarelli em 29/01/2010


Introdução



O IceWarp Mail Server é uma solução confiável, fácil de gerenciar, de usar e com preço competitivo, usada por mais de 50 milhões de usuários em todo o mundo.

Este poderoso servidor de email contém recursos únicos, sendo compatível com todos os principais protocolos, como SMTP, POP3, IMAP4, incluindo criptografia de dados. Oferece, ainda, MySQL e suporte ODBC para armazenamento de contas/Groupware/Anti-spam, suporte a balanceamento de carga, integração com LDAP e Active Directory, administração de contas via web e console em português.

Em conformidade com os padrões Internet (RFC), o IceWarp suporta os protocolos: SMTP/ESMTP, IMAPv4 incl. PUSH através do comando IDLE, IMAP ACL, POP3/SPOP3, APOP, HTTP(S), FTP(S) com OTP/S-Key, OpenLDAP, SIP, SIP SIMPLE, Jabber/XMPP, HTTP Proxy, TLS/SSL 128-bit para todos os serviços, IPv6 incl, registros DNS AAAA, SNMPv2, WebDAV, GroupDAV, CalDAV, SyncML, iCal (vCal, vCard, vNote e vFreeBusy), suporte completo Unicode (UTF-8), métodos de criptografia SHA1/MD5/DigestMD5 RSA.

1) Faça download da versão oficial do IceWarp Server em:
Veja nessa página a URL para o instalador e faça o download utilizando o wget:

Versão RH 4 & CentOS 4
http://www2.icewarp.com.br/downloads/linux_platform/rh4merak-9.4.2.tar.gz

Versão RH 5 & CentOS 5
http://www2.icewarp.com.br/downloads/linux_platform/merak-9.4.2_RHEL5.3.tar.gz

Obs.: IceWarp Mail Server é certificado para uso no Red Hat Enterprise Linux (ou CentOS) 5, sem necessidade de symlinks. Em breve, suporte a outras distribuições.

2) Agora vamos descompactar o arquivo utilizando o comando:

# tar -zxvf icewarp.tar.gz

3) Depois de descompactar o arquivo, acesse a pasta icewarp e execute o script de instalação:

# ./install.sh

O produto já vem com os recursos, como webmail em português. Entretanto, devem ser feito alguns ajustes adicionais, por exemplo, para que o webmail carregue em português por padrão, bem como caso deseja instalar o corretor ortográfico Aspell:
4) Durante o processo de instalação você deve escolher o usuário e grupo abaixo dos quais serão executados os serviços. Caso deixe usuário e grupo em branco, o IceWarp Server utilizará o usuário root (recomendado).

5) Utilize a ferramenta wizard para criação de domínios e contas, gerenciamento de licenças e manipulação de bancos de dados. Para acesso a ferramenta wizard, utilize o seguinte comando:

# cd /opt/merak/
# ./wizard.sh


6) Agora você deve criar um domínio e uma conta de administrador para ter acesso à administração remota, bem como via web.
**      Root menu
**      ---------
**
**      You have the following options:
**
**      [1] Accounts and Domains management
**      [2] License operations
**      [3] Storage setup
**
**      [0] Return
**      [Q] Exit
**
**      Enter your choice:

Escolha a opção 1 para gerenciamento de contas e domínios.

**      Accounts and Domains management
**      -------------------------------
**
**      You have the following options:
**
**      [1] Add new domain
**      [2] Delete domain
**      [3] Add new user
**      [4] Delete user
**
**      [0] Return
**      [Q] Exit
**
**      Enter your choice:

Agora escolha opção 1 para criar um novo domínio.

      Accounts and Domains management
**      -------------------------------
**
**      You have the following options:
**
**      [1] Add new domain
**      [2] Delete domain
**      [3] Add new user
**      [4] Delete user
**
**      [0] Return
**      [Q] Exit
**
**      Enter your choice: 3

Depois de criar o novo domínio, escolha a opção 3 para criar uma conta.

      Accounts and Domains management
**      -------------------------------
**
**      You have the following options:
**
**      [1] Add new domain
**      [2] Delete domain
**      [3] Add new user
**      [4] Delete user
**
**      [0] Return
**      [Q] Exit
**
**      Enter your choice: 3

Durante o processo de criação da conta, o IceWarp server indaga se a mesma deve ser do tipo administradora. Ao informar que sim, estará criando um conta com direitos completos, permitindo acesso completo via console Windows ou via web, conforme citado anteriormente.

7) Para acessar o seu webmail PRO, utilize o seguinte endereço: http://localhost:32000/webmail

Para administração utilize o endereço http://localhost:32000/admin ou no lugar do localhost indique o IP da máquina.

Outra opção é utilizar o console de administração via Windows que permite administração remota do IceWarp Server a partir de computador rodando Windows. Inclui a opção para acessar em português (Options/languages) ativada por padrão. A versão do console deve ser sempre a mesma do seu servidor IceWarp. Link para download:
8) Você também pode utilizar a ferramenta Tool para administrar o servidor.

A ferramenta Command Line Tool permite acesso direto à API do IceWarp e a possibilidade de efetuar mudanças em múltiplas contas de uma só vez.

No help (F1) do console IceWarp há informações sobre o tool, bem como você pode digitar "./tool.sh --tutorial" para exemplos. Há opções avançadas, como a possibilidade de uso do Tool remotamente e a realização de queries.

As constantes estão todas descritas em icewarp/api/delphi/apiconst.pas.

Vejamos alguns exemplos de uso...

No arquivo apiconst.pas você encontra que a constante referente à senha do usuário é u_password.

Você pode utilizar o seguinte comando:

# ./tool.sh display account *@* u_password

Serão exibidas todas senhas de usuários, exceto as de contas administradoras (para exibí-las também, desative a opção "Senhas de administradores não podem ser exibidas em Políticas/Política de Senha").

Veja alguns exemplos adicionais:

1) ./tool.sh create account teste@teste.com u_password senha

Cria uma conta teste@teste.com com a senha "senha".

2) ./tool.sh modify account *@dominio.com.br u_maxbox 1 u_maxboxsize 50000 u_maxmessagesize 13000

O seguinte exemplo altera o tamanho da caixa postal e tamanho máximo de mensagem em todas as contas do domínio dominio.com.br:

3) ./tool.sh display system C_Mail_SMTP_General_DNSServer

Exibe os servidores DNS especificados em System/Internet Connection (Sistema/Conexão Internet). Esses servidores são utilizados para resolução de MX e outras consultas de DNS.

4) ./tool.sh modify system C_Mail_SMTP_General_DNSServer 208.67.222.222;208.67.220.22

Modifica servidores de DNS.

5) ./tool.sh export account *@* u_backup > contas.txt

./tool.sh import account contas.txt u_backup

Uma constante bastante útil é u_backup (e d_backup), que contém backup de todas configurações da conta do usuário (backup da estrutura da conta, encaminhamentos, senha, tipo de conta). Você pode usá-la juntamente com o comando export e import, para exportar uma conta e importar em outro IceWarp. O mesmo pode ser feito com a variável u_backup. Veja exemplo de exportação e importação de uma conta com todos seus dados:

6) ./tool.sh export account *@teste.com > teste.txt

Exporta todas as contas do domínio teste.com para o arquivo teste.txt.

7) ./tool.sh import account teste.txt

Importa todas contas do arquivo texto anteriormente gerado. Útil para migrar contas de um domínio para outro.

8) ./tool.sh display account *@* u_name u_password > contas.txt

O comando gera uma lista de usuários (nome completo) e senhas em arquivo texto.

9) ./tool.sh -filter="U_AuthMode = 3" get account *@* u_alias > any.txt

Exibe todas as contas que possuem any password ativado, ou seja permite efetuar login com qualquer senha. Vale ressaltar que a opção de filter/query (-f) funciona apenas com nomes de campos que existam na API (icewap\delphi\apiconst.pas) e não sejam diferentes no banco de dados.

Em caso de qualquer dúvida, solicite a criação de um usuário em nosso sistema de suporte, acessando ao opção "Fale conosco" do nosso site e marcando o checkbox desejo obter suporte. Você também terá acesso ao nosso vídeo com treinamento completo. Veja também nossos FAQs em http://suporte.icewarp.com.br.

   

Páginas do artigo
   1. Introdução
Outros artigos deste autor
Nenhum artigo encontrado.
Leitura recomendada

Evosign - Adicionar assinatura automática ao Evolution

Exim4 com MailScanner + Clamav

Email + EGroupWare + Active Directory

Solução corporativa Expresso Livre, substituto de peso do Notes

Servidor de e-mail com anti-vírus: MailScanner + Exim + Clamav + Cpanel/WHM

  
Comentários

Nenhum comentário foi encontrado.


Contribuir com comentário




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ts